Enhanced Training Collaboration Between Vietnam and Japan

Vietnam and Japan are reinforcing their collaboration in human resource development, with an emphasis on elevating the competencies of grassroots officials and improving governance standards. This initiative underscores a broader dedication to sustainable institutional development and global cooperation in public administration.

In a pivotal meeting at the Government Headquarters in Hanoi, Deputy Prime Minister Pham Thi Thanh Tra engaged with Honna Hitoshi, the Chairman and CEO of Erex Group. Their discussions aimed to evaluate existing cooperation and identify methods to further enhance training initiatives across both nations.

The Vietnamese leader acknowledged the joint training program facilitated by the Ministry of Interior alongside Erex Group that commenced in 2022. This endeavor has been instrumental in boosting public management abilities, especially among young civil servants, grassroots officials, and women leaders, aiding their adaptation to contemporary governance needs.

To date, nearly 300 Vietnamese officials have participated in training sessions in Japan, gaining invaluable international insights and practical expertise. The program's impact has been profound, with many attendees successfully implementing their newly acquired skills locally. Notably, approximately 60 percent of youth who completed the training have ascended to higher positions, showcasing the initiative's effectiveness and relevance.

Deputy Prime Minister Pham Thi Thanh Tra stated that cultivating a proficient workforce remains a primary objective for the Vietnamese government. She underscored that international collaboration efforts like this not only enhance administrative capabilities but also play a crucial role in establishing a modern governance framework that addresses the challenges of a rapidly changing global landscape.

Honna Hitoshi, in response, recognized Vietnam’s recent advancements in strengthening its governance and leadership framework for the period 2026–2031. He reaffirmed Erex Group's dedication to maintaining and expanding its partnership with Vietnam, particularly within human resource development—a core element for sustainable growth.

The meeting concluded with mutual optimism regarding the prospects for Vietnam-Japan cooperation. Both parties shared a consensus that ongoing collaboration in training and capacity enhancement will be pivotal in supporting Vietnam’s socio-economic development and solidifying bilateral relations between the two countries.
